Cross Domain Scripting

Door Niels , 16 jaar geleden, 3.463x bekeken

Het mogelijk maken scripts te bouwen op meerdere Domeinen

Gesponsorde koppelingen

Inhoudsopgave

  1. Inleiding
  2. Cross Domain Scripting, wat nu weer?
  3. JSON mogelijkheden

 

Er zijn 16 reacties op 'Cross domain scripting'

PHP hulp
PHP hulp
0 seconden vanaf nu
 

Gesponsorde koppelingen
 
0 +1 -0 -1
Eehm, dit is dus de veredelde (JavaScript) versie van een frame?

Misschien een idee om met (als men beschikking heeft daarover) PHP een oplossing te verzinnen, die snel is (dus liever niet fopen)?
Roland Baas
Roland Baas
16 jaar geleden
 
0 +1 -0 -1
Interessant onderwerp! ben benieuwd naar de rest van de tutorial...
Leroy Boerefijn
Leroy Boerefijn
16 jaar geleden
 
0 +1 -0 -1
met php kan je tog gewoon includen??
of snap ik de bedoeling niet helemaal??
Zero Dead
Zero Dead
16 jaar geleden
 
0 +1 -0 -1
Misschien toch iets toevoegen voor browsers die geen JavaScript ondersteunen:

Code (php)
PHP script in nieuw venster Selecteer het PHP script
1
2
<script type="text/javascript" src="http://jourserver.com/yourfile.js"></script>
<noscript><iframe src="http://yourserver.com/yourscript.php" /></noscript>


16 jaar geleden
 
0 +1 -0 -1
AJAX?

Maar als je server geen PHP ondersteund schakel dan gewoon over na een server die dat wel ondersteund. Dit is geen oplossing, dit is om het probleem heen lopen.
Niels
Niels
16 jaar geleden
 
0 +1 -0 -1
@WebMakererij.
Er zijn mensen die dit omstreden vinden en op hun eigen server willen blijven.
En nee AJAX en XMLDOC zijn geen oplossingen, tenminste, je kan er geen PHP mee openen dat op andere webservers staat.

Maar daar over meer
Frank -
Frank -
16 jaar geleden
 
0 +1 -0 -1
Wat is er mis met een RSS-feed? RSS-feeds zijn gemaakt om informatie te delen, dat kun je van Javascript niet zeggen. Tevens ben je volledig afhankelijk van de instellingen van de browser en dat lijkt mij een bijzonder ongewenste situatie.

Wanneer een klant geen server wil hebben met PHP (waarom niet?), zoek dan een oplossing in bv. ASP of een andere taal die w?l beschikbaar is. En een klant die helemaal geen serverside-parser wil hebben, maar wel volledig afhankelijk wil zijn van de bezoekers, die kan ik niet serieus nemen. Laten we eerlijk zijn, dan gaat helemaal nergens meer over.
Niels
Niels
16 jaar geleden
 
0 +1 -0 -1
Frank in wezen heb je gelijk, maar ik heb toevallig een klant gehad en heb hem kunnen helpen. heb hem wel geholpen en ik kan er weer van eten. dus serieus neem ik al mijn klanten.

Ik vind dat je ongeacht de wensen van je klant al je klanten een zo goed mogelijke oplossing moet bieden. Hij had mij expliciet gevraagd dit te onderzoeken dus heb ik dit gedaan. Doe je het niet ben je het ook niet waard om klanten te krijgen en ze te helpen zowaar je kan. Nu zeg ik niet dat deze "techniek" je van het is maar het bied mogelijkheden.

Ten 2e: zou een RSS feed dit kunnen:

Stel je hebt een prachtig CMS gemaakt: met het oog op de aftersales die je gaat doen bij een klant heb je een update module ingebouwd die netzo werkt als de windows update manager. je krijgt een bericht als je inlogt en er zijn updates beschikbaar. en daar kun je aangeven welke update hij moet installeren en wanneer.
Dit kan volgens mij niet met RSS? wat wel kan met deze techniek.
Niels
Niels
16 jaar geleden
 
0 +1 -0 -1
[update]

ik heb JSON er aan toegevoegd de credits gaan naar:
http://borkweb.com/story/look-ma-cross-domain-scripting

[/update]

Ik weet dat het niet handig is dat alles met javascirpt moet, maar er is eenmaal geen andere weg, zonder dat je gigantisch veel code moet schrijven:
proxy, soap, curl. etc.

Ik zocht een oplossing van ongeveer 1 tot 3 lijnen, en die heb ik bij deze gevonden :).

Hopelijk zijn er meer mensen met mij eens dat het wel eens handig kan zijn.
Nu nog opzoek naar ene goeie beveiliging :P
- -
- -
16 jaar geleden
 
0 +1 -0 -1
Kan iemand mij en hostingprovider aanwijzen die geen php of asp ondersteund? ja, misschien mn neef met een zolderservertje, maar elke host ondersteund wel ?f php ?f asp of iets anders waardoor dit nutteloos wordt.
Niels
Niels
16 jaar geleden
 
0 +1 -0 -1
Dat maakt niet uit, het gaat er om dat het mogelijk is, wil je er een vinden:

www.google.com.
wie weet kan je het dan nog vinden ook.
Wou gewoon duidelijk maken aan de hand van een voorbeeld wat de mogelijkheden zijn. Als je soms beter weet, waarom post je die niet?
Frank -
Frank -
16 jaar geleden
 
0 +1 -0 -1
Wat heeft een update-module nu te maken met een stukje Javascript? Helemaal niets. De update-module ontvangt een bericht (bv. rss-feed, maar kan ook per email), leest dit bericht en zet het op het scherm. Op basis van de gegevens in het bericht worden er selectboxen getoond om aan te geven wat er kan worden geinstalleerd, etc. etc. Ik zie echt niet in waarom je hier Javascript nodig hebt.

Met Javascript laat jij de browser met de server kletsen, maar zeker bij updates e.d. wil jij de ene server met de andere server laten kletsen. De updates staan tenslotte op die andere server! Dat je nog even via de browser een berichtje wilt tonen en de gebruiker wat installatie-keuzes geeft, maakt de boel gebruikersvriendelijker. Maar Javascript? En geinig extraatje, maar niet meer dan dat.

En wat klanten betreft, ik neem mijn klanten serieus. Zo serieus, dat wanneer zij met een slecht idee aankomen en mij vragen om dat uit te voeren, ik met een beter voorstel kom. Willen ze desondanks met dit slechte idee verder gaan, dan zullen ze dat zonder mijn kennis en kunde moeten doen. Ik ga mijn goede naam niet te grabbel gooien voor een klant met slechte ideeen. Vroeg of laat keert zo'n klant zich tegen jou en ben jij verantwoordelijk voor de puinhopen. En reken er maar op dat potentieele klanten dit soort slechte verhalen ook te horen krijgen! 'nee' verkopen is ook een kunst en daar kun je een betere waardering voor krijgen dan voor een slechte oplossing.
Niels
Niels
16 jaar geleden
 
0 +1 -0 -1
Ok wist niet dat dat ook kon met RSS, dus je kan met rss ook on the fly een xml bestand refreshen (kijken of het recent genoeg is en anders updaten)?

Ik bedoelde er niks persoonlijks mee, maar goed. Wij geven de klant een uitgebreid verslag met de oplossingen voor hun problemen, dit doen wij al 6 jaar. 6 jaar lang geen probleem gehad. Komt de klant met een slecht idee raden wij dit echt wel af. Wil de klant er toch verder mee, dan zullen wij dit zeker doen. Maar wel onder voorwaarden dat wij niet verantwoordelijk zijn. Klant is koning, maar wij zijn keizer. Zoals het spreekwoord veelvuldig luid.

Het is ook niet de bedoeling Javascript te gebruiken, het was naar mijn idee de enigste oplossing. Aangezien er meerdere modules in komen.


16 jaar geleden
 
0 +1 -0 -1
Quote:
Kan iemand mij en hostingprovider aanwijzen die geen php of asp ondersteund? ja, misschien mn neef met een zolderservertje, maar elke host ondersteund wel ?f php ?f asp of iets anders waardoor dit nutteloos wordt.


Helemaal niet waar. Daarnaast nemen server-side programmeer talen meteen meer server belasting en risico's met zich mee.

Maar goed, u vraagt wij draaien: static hosting
Hipska BE
Hipska BE
16 jaar geleden
 
0 +1 -0 -1
iedereen die bij telenet klant is krijgt gratis 50MB webruimte, hier werkt geen php of asp op.
zie maar hier
PHP hulp
PHP hulp
0 seconden vanaf nu
 

Gesponsorde koppelingen
Rudie dirkx
rudie dirkx
16 jaar geleden
 
0 +1 -0 -1
Inleiding:
Quote:
Aangezien de mogelijkheden potentieel zijn (..)


Huh wat betekent dat??

Om te reageren heb je een account nodig en je moet ingelogd zijn.

Inhoudsopgave

  1. Inleiding
  2. Cross Domain Scripting, wat nu weer?
  3. JSON mogelijkheden

Labels

  • Geen tags toegevoegd.

PHP tutorial opties

 
 

Om de gebruiksvriendelijkheid van onze website en diensten te optimaliseren maken wij gebruik van cookies. Deze cookies gebruiken wij voor functionaliteiten, analytische gegevens en marketing doeleinden. U vindt meer informatie in onze privacy statement.